lofty
https://gyazo.com/1d9d8d68bae155a822a84df0904e8374
adjective (loftier, loftiest)
1. of imposing height:
⦅文⦆ そびえ立つ, 非常に高い〈山・建物など〉; 天井が高い〈部屋など〉
e.g. the elegant square was shaded by lofty palms.
of a noble or exalted nature:
高尚な, 気高い, 高貴な〈考え方・信念など〉
e.g. an extraordinary mixture of harsh reality and lofty ideals.
proud, aloof, or self-important:
⦅けなして⦆ 高慢な, 尊大な〈態度・物腰など〉
e.g. lofty intellectual disdain.
2. (of wool and other textiles) thick and resilient.
厚みと弾力のある〈毛織物など〉
DERIVATIVES
loftily |ˈlôfdəlē, ˈläfdəlē| adverb
loftiness |ˈlôftēnəs| noun
ORIGIN
Middle English: from loft, influenced by aloft.
